Subject: Re: [9fans] how to undo in Rio shell window and Acme editor?

Even if you are not in a `win` window (eg. if you are in an +Error one) you can use Undo. Sometimes Acme doesn't actually put Undo in the tag line, but if you type it out yourself it will still work. Well, at least on p9p Acme, I'm not sure about Plan 9 Acme.

> > i cannot speak for acme but rio has no undo buffer, so what you ask for is not possible.
> > 
> > you can save a windows content (including history). e.g. /dev/wsys/11/text /tmp (assuming the window you want is number 11, cat /dev/winid to get the current windows id)
